botch

botch [ boch ]


transitive verb  (past and past participle botched, present participle botch·ing, 3rd person present singular botch·es)
Definition:
 
do something badly: to do something very badly out of clumsiness or lack of care
managed to botch a simple repair job
botched the piano concerto up



noun botch (plural botch·es) 
Definition:
 
badly done job: a job or task that has been done very badly

[14th century. Origin ?]

botch·er noun
botch·i·ly adverb
botch·i·ness noun
botch·y adjective
